On January 22nd the Budgeting for Foreign Affairs and Defense program
hosted Major General Kenneth F. McKenzie, Marine Corps Representative to the
Quadrennial Defense Review.  Russell Rumbaugh, director of the BFAD
program, then moderated a panel discussion featuring MajGen McKenzie, Dr. Maren
Leed, Senior Adviser at CSIS, and Benjamin
Friedman, Research Fellow at the Cato Institute. A complete recording of the
event is available here, and news reports regarding the event are
provided below.
